Demographics

Healy has a population of 347 with a median age of 49.1. Here is the racial and ethnic breakdown of the population:

Income & Economy

The median household income in Healy is $50,313, which is 37.6% below the national median of $80,610. The per capita income is $29,202. The poverty rate is 1.4%.

Education

In Healy, 80.8% of residents age 25+ have a high school diploma or higher, and 15.7% hold a bachelor's degree or higher (7.3% with a graduate or professional degree).

Housing

The median home value in Healy is $65,800, below the national median of $303,400. The median monthly rent is $675. The homeownership rate is 63.8%.

Is Healy, Kansas an affordable place to live?
The home price-to-income ratio in Healy, Kansas is 1.3x (median home value $65,800 vs. median income $50,313), making it relatively affordable by that measure. A ratio under 4.0 is generally considered affordable.
